
* {
margin : auto;
}
body {
font : normal 12px Tahoma, Verdana, Helvetica, Arial, sans-serif;
color : #c9c9c9;
margin-top : 0;
margin-bottom : 0;
background : #4f4528 url(images/body_bkg.gif);
text-align : center;
}
tr {
vertical-align : top;
}
td {
font : normal 12px Tahoma, Verdana, Helvetica, Arial, sans-serif;
vertical-align : top;
text-align : center;
}
table {
margin : 0 auto;
}
a {
color : #ffefbe;
text-decoration : none;
}
a:hover {
color : #cc6000;
text-decoration : underline;
}

/*Header top*/
.header_top{
background: url(images/header_09.jpg) no-repeat left;
width:297px;
height:80px;
border: 0px solid #009949;
}
.header_top a{
font-size:11px;
font-weight:bold;
text-decoration:none;
color: #ffefbe;
}
.header_top a:hover{
text-decoration:underline;
color: #009949;
}
.top_head_column{
width:148px;
height:80px;
padding:2px 0 0 3px;
border: 0px solid #009949;
text-align:left;
}

/*Header Buttons*/
.header_buttons_brown{
vertical-align:middle;
background:  url(images/button_brown_bkg.jpg) no-repeat left;
}
.header_buttons_green{
vertical-align:middle;
background:  url(images/button_green_bkg.jpg) no-repeat left;
}
.cat_link a{
color:#c9c9c9;
font-weight:bold;
font-size: 12px;
text-decoration: none;
}
.cat_link a:hover{
color:#ffefbe;
font-weight:bold;
font-size: 12px;
text-decoration: none;
}

/*Thumbs*/
#thumbs {
background:none;
border :none;
}
#thumbs img {
border : 1px solid #4f4528;
margin-bottom : 5px;
margin-top : 5px;
}
#thumbs a:hover img {
border : 1px solid #cc6000;
}

/*Top Traders Block*/
#toptraders {
width : 992px;
border : none;
text-align : left;
background : none;
}
#toptraders td {
width : 20%;
padding-left : 3px;
padding-top : 6px;
padding-bottom : 6px;
border : none;
font-size:14px;
text-align : left;
}
#toptraders a{
color: #ffefbe;
font-weight:bold; 
}
#toptraders a:hover{
color: #009949;
font-weight:bold; 
}

/*Paysite block*/
#paysites {
width : 992px;
border : none;
text-align : left;
background : none;
}
#paysites td {
width : 20%;
padding-left : 3px;
padding-top : 6px;
padding-bottom : 6px;
border : none;
font-size:14px;
text-align : left;
}
#paysites a{
color: #ffefbe;
font-weight:bold; 
}
#paysites a:hover{
color: #009949;
font-weight:bold; 
}


.custom_text {
color : red;
font-weight : bold;
}
.custom_text_2 {
color : #c9c9c9;
font-size:11px;
}
.big_orange_text{
color:orange;
font-weight:bold;
font-size:15px;
}

/*Footer*/
#footer {
width : 665px;
height : 110px;
background : url(images/footer.gif) no-repeat bottom left;
border:0px solid red;
}

#footer p {
width : 450px;
height : 100px;
margin:0 0 0 200px;
font-size : 12px;
text-align : center;
color : #c9c9c9;
border:0px solid red;
}
#footer a {
color : #009949;
text-decoration : underline;
}
#footer a:hover {
color : #c9c9c9;
text-decoration : none;
}
.webmasters {
font-weight : bold;
font-size : 17px;
font-style:italic;
}

/*Advert big link*/
.big_link {
font-weight : bold;
font-size : 18px;
}
.big_txt {
font-weight : bold;
font-size : 14px;
margin:0 10px 0 0;
}


#description_block{
width:992px;
}
#description_block img {
border : none;
margin : 7px 3px 0 5px;
}
.description_block {
line-height: 15px;
padding:5px 0 5px 0;
width : 50%;
border : none;
text-align : left;
background : none;
}

/*Frame*/
.topleft {
width : 14px;
height : 98px;
background : url(images/frame_topleft.gif) no-repeat center;
background-position: bottom;
}
.topright {
width : 14px;
height : 98px;
background : url(images/frame_topright.gif) no-repeat center;
background-position: bottom;
}
.bottleft {
width : 14px;
height : 14px;
background : url(images/frame_bottleft.gif) no-repeat center;
}
.bottright {
width : 14px;
height : 14px;
background : url(images/frame_bottright.gif) no-repeat center;
}
.top {
width : 992px;
height : 35px;
background : url(images/frame_top.gif) repeat-x;
background-position: bottom;
}
.left {
width : 14px;
height : 100%;
background : url(images/frame_left.gif) repeat-y top;
}
.bottom {
width : 992px;
height : 14px;
background : url(images/frame_bottom.gif) repeat-x left;
}
.right {
width : 14px;
height : 100%;
background : url(images/frame_right.gif) repeat-y top;
}

/*Title Background*/
.title_bkg{
width : 1020px;
height : 29px;
background : url(images/title_bkg.gif) no-repeat center;	
border:none;
}
.title_bkg_2{
width : 1020px;
height : 29px;
background : url(images/title_bkg_2.gif) no-repeat center;	
border:none;
}
.space_1{
width:332px;
border:0px solid red;
}
.space_2{
width:162px;
border:0px solid red;
}
.title_text{
width:357px;
height:30px;
font-size:18px;
font-weight:bold;color:#d7b5a5;
padding-top:3px;
border:0px solid red;
}
.bookmark_text{
padding-top:3px;
width:169px;
border:0px solid red;
}
.bookmark_text a{
font-size:16px;
font-weight:bold;
text-decoration:underline;
font-style:italic;
color:#ffefbe;
}
.bookmark_text a:hover{
text-decoration:none;
color:#c9c9c9;
}

/*Archives text*/
.archives{
border:0px solid red;
}
.archive_title{
font-weight:bold;
padding-top:3px;
color:#ffefbe;
}
.archive_num{
width:22px;
height:23px;
padding-top:3px;
background : url(images/arch_num_bkg.gif) no-repeat center;	
}
.px_space{
width:3px;
}
